An LED backlight for a handheld LCD device LCDs never deliver gentle by themselves, so that they have to have external gentle to create a visual picture.[eighty two][eighty three] Inside a transmissive form of Liquid crystal display, The sunshine resource is supplied in the back of the glass stack and is referred to as a backlight.
In 2004, scientists within the College of Oxford shown two new different types of zero-electricity bistable LCDs based upon Zenithal bistable techniques.[146] A number of bistable technologies, just like the 360° BTN as well as bistable cholesteric, count mostly on the bulk Qualities of the liquid crystal (LC) and use common robust anchoring, with alignment movies and LC mixtures comparable to the normal monostable elements.

OLED (Organic Mild Emitting Diodes) is often a flat light-weight emitting technologies, made by putting a series of organic and natural slim movies in between two conductors.
TN (Twisted Nematic): Nematic liquid crystal is positioned amongst two glass plates in This system. The liquid crystals twist at 90° when electrical energy is placed on the electrodes.
The majority of the new M+ technology was utilized on 4K TV sets which brought about a controversy just after exams confirmed which the addition of the white sub pixel changing the standard RGB construction experienced also been accompanied by a reduction in resolution by all over twenty five%. This meant that a "4K" M+ Tv set would not display the complete UHD Television standard. The media and World-wide-web customers identified as them "RGBW" TVs due to the white sub pixel.
Although it has improved good quality, OLED units tend to possess a a lot more premium cost tag. That is why OLED is at the moment only the primary choice for large-finish cell units and TVs. LCD displays are inexpensive, and LCD TVs have almost as high photograph good quality. The price of OLED goods may perhaps arrive down in the future, but hasn’t demonstrated indications of happening shortly. LCD panels even have the added good thing about obtaining a higher utmost luminance making it greater for bright spaces or destinations with direct daylight.
So, do liquid crystals act like solids or liquids or something else? It turns out that liquid crystals are nearer to a liquid state than a good. It requires a good amount of heat to alter a suitable substance from a good into a liquid crystal, and it only normally takes a little bit more warmth to turn that same liquid crystal into a real liquid.
